His extensive work in comedy, directing specials for renowned performers including Taylor Tomlinson, Sam Jay, Michael Che, Ilana Glazer, Hannibal Buress, Phoebe Robinson, and Aida Rodriguez, demonstrates his exceptional ability to capture authentic performances while maintaining each artist's unique comedic voice.
The award-winning short film "Mela" marked a significant milestone in Mercado's career, premiering at Slamdance and earning praise for its nuanced integration of cultural narratives with contemporary social issues. His innovative approach to storytelling has been consistently recognized by the industry, earning him multiple prestigious honors including wins at both SXSW and Slamdance, as well as two Webby Awards for his groundbreaking work in digital media.
